A.B.C. From School Grounds …. to School Garden

Garden Schools is an educational programme developed by One Seed Forward and the School of Education in the University of Aberdeen. Its aim is to involve schools in being active participants in creating a physical space that can be used to increase outdoor learning and educate pupils in the benefits of growing their own food.
In this module the materials take teachers through the processes of designing a garden with pupils.
